Parish council

At its meeting held from 26 January to 2 February 2025, the general assembly of Pärnu St Elizabeth’s Parish elected Indrek Kaldo, Priit Kalle, Tähti Karro, Priit Kogeri, Kasper Koodi, Diego Lina, Sulev Lonni, Jüri Martinson, Aime Nigola, Osvald Nigola, Jüri Pikma, Marika Priske, Andres Riivitsa, Ille Riivitsa, Hillar Talviku and Aime Vinni to the parish council.
Aino Toht, Tiia Lehepuu, Külli Kodasmaa, Annely Triksberg and Paul Zubtšenko were elected as substitute members.
Parish board
The chair of the board is Andres Riivits (andres.riivits@eelk.ee). The other board members are Priit Kalle, Jüri Martinson, Jüri Pikma and Marika Priske. The parish pastor and assistant pastor are members of the board by virtue of their office.

Hostel Lõuna
The parish also owns Hotel/Hostel Lõuna at Lõuna 2, in the very centre of Pärnu. The hotel is on the ground floor and the hostel on the first floor. By staying there, you support the work of the parish and the restoration of Pärnu St Elizabeth’s Church.
